What are Design Tokens?
At their core, design tokens are the fundamental building blocks of a visual design system. They represent the smallest, indivisible parts of a design, such as colors, typography styles, spacing values, animation timings, and other visual attributes. Instead of hardcoding these values directly into CSS, JavaScript, or native code, design tokens abstract them into a single source of truth.
Think of them as named entities that store design decisions. For example, instead of writing color: #007bff; in your CSS, you might use a design token like --color-primary-blue. This token would then be defined with the value #007bff.
These tokens can take various forms, including:
- Core Tokens: The most atomic values, like a specific color hex code (e.g.,
#333) or a font size (e.g.,16px). - Component Tokens: Derived from core tokens, these define specific properties for UI components (e.g.,
button-background-color: var(--color-primary-blue)). - Semantic Tokens: These are context-aware tokens that map design properties to their meaning or purpose (e.g.,
color-background-danger: var(--color-red-500)). This allows for easier theming and accessibility adjustments.
The Crucial Need for Cross-Platform Consistency
The proliferation of devices and screen sizes has amplified the importance of a consistent user experience. Users interact with brands across diverse touchpoints, and any disconnect can lead to confusion, frustration, and a weakened brand perception.
Why Consistency Matters Globally:
- Brand Recognition and Trust: A consistent visual language across all platforms reinforces brand identity, making it instantly recognizable and fostering trust. Users feel more secure when a familiar look and feel guide their interactions.
- Improved Usability and Learnability: When design patterns, navigation elements, and interactive behaviors are consistent, users can leverage their existing knowledge from one platform to another. This reduces cognitive load and makes the learning curve much gentler.
- Reduced Development Overhead: By having a single source of truth for design properties, teams can avoid redundant work and ensure that changes are propagated efficiently across all platforms. This significantly speeds up development cycles.
- Enhanced Accessibility: Design tokens, particularly semantic tokens, can be instrumental in managing accessibility concerns. For instance, adjusting color contrast for accessibility guidelines can be done by updating a single token value, which then propagates across all components and platforms.
- Scalability and Maintainability: As a product or service grows and evolves, so does its design. A well-managed design token system makes it easier to scale the design, introduce new themes, or update existing styles without breaking existing implementations.

The Role of Design Tokens in Achieving Cross-Platform Consistency
Design tokens act as the bridge between design and development, ensuring that design decisions are translated accurately and consistently across different technological stacks and platforms.
How Design Tokens Enable Consistency:
- Single Source of Truth: All design decisions – colors, typography, spacing, etc. – are defined in one place. This eliminates the need to maintain separate style guides or hardcoded values for each platform.
- Platform Agnosticism: Tokens themselves are platform-agnostic. They can be transformed into platform-specific formats (e.g., CSS variables, Swift UIColor, Android XML attributes, JSON) by tooling. This means the core design decision remains the same, but its implementation adapts.
- Theming Capabilities: Design tokens are fundamental to creating robust theming systems. By simply swapping out the values of semantic tokens, you can change the entire look and feel of an application to support different brands, moods, or accessibility needs. Imagine a dark mode theme, a high-contrast theme for accessibility, or different brand themes for regional variations – all managed through token manipulation.
- Facilitating Collaboration: When designers and developers work with a shared vocabulary of design tokens, communication becomes clearer and less prone to misinterpretation. Designers can specify tokens in their mockups, and developers can directly consume them in their code.
- Automated Documentation: Tools that work with design tokens can often automatically generate documentation, ensuring that the design system's language is always up-to-date and accessible to everyone on the team.
Implementing Design Tokens: A Practical Approach
Adopting design tokens requires a structured approach, from defining the tokens to integrating them into your development workflow.
1. Defining Your Design Tokens:
Start by auditing your existing design system or creating a new one from scratch. Identify the core visual elements that will form your tokens.
Key Token Categories:
- Colors: Define your primary, secondary, accent, grayscale, and semantic colors (e.g.,
--color-primary-blue-500,--color-danger-red-700,--color-text-default). - Typography: Define font families, sizes, weights, and line heights (e.g.,
--font-family-sans-serif,--font-size-large,--line-height-body). - Spacing: Define consistent padding, margins, and gaps (e.g.,
--spacing-medium,--spacing-unit-4). - Borders and Shadows: Define border radii, widths, and box shadows (e.g.,
--border-radius-small,--shadow-medium). - Sizes: Define common element dimensions (e.g.,
--size-button-height,--size-icon-small). - Durations and Easing: Define animation timings and easing functions (e.g.,
--duration-fast,--easing-easeInOut).
2. Choosing a Token Format:
Design tokens are often stored in JSON or YAML format. This structured data can then be processed by various tools.
Example JSON Structure:
{
"color": {
"primary": {
"500": "#007bff"
},
"text": {
"default": "#212529"
}
},
"spacing": {
"medium": "16px"
},
"typography": {
"fontSize": {
"body": "16px"
},
"fontWeight": {
"bold": "700"
}
}
}
3. Token Transformation and Consumption:
This is where the magic happens. Tools are used to transform your token definitions into formats usable by different platforms.
Popular Tooling:
- Style Dictionary: An open-source token transformation and platform-agnostic library from Amazon. It's widely used to generate CSS custom properties, SASS/LESS variables, Swift, Android XML, and more from a single source.
- Tokens Studio for Figma: A popular Figma plugin that allows designers to define tokens directly within Figma. These tokens can then be exported in various formats, including those compatible with Style Dictionary.
- Custom Scripts: For highly specific workflows, custom scripts can be written to process token files and generate necessary code.
Example of Style Dictionary Output (CSS):
:root {
--color-primary-500: #007bff;
--color-text-default: #212529;
--spacing-medium: 16px;
--font-size-body: 16px;
--font-weight-bold: 700;
}
Example of Style Dictionary Output (Swift for iOS):
import SwiftUI
extension Color {
static let primary500: Color = Color(red: 0/255, green: 123/255, blue: 255/255)
static let textDefault: Color = Color(red: 33/255, green: 37/255, blue: 41/255)
}
4. Integrating Tokens into Your Frontend Frameworks:
Once tokens are transformed, they need to be integrated into your respective frontend projects.
Web (React/Vue/Angular):
CSS custom properties are the most common way to consume tokens. Frameworks can import generated CSS files or use them directly.

Mobile (iOS/Android):
Use the generated platform-specific code (e.g., Swift, Kotlin, XML) to reference your design tokens as constants or style definitions.
// In Android (Kotlin)
val primaryColor = context.resources.getColor(R.color.primary_500, null)
val mediumSpacing = context.resources.getDimensionPixelSize(R.dimen.spacing_medium)
// Usage in a View
myButton.setBackgroundColor(primaryColor)
myButton.setPadding(mediumSpacing, mediumSpacing, mediumSpacing, mediumSpacing)
Challenges and Best Practices
While the benefits are clear, implementing design tokens effectively can come with its own set of challenges. Here are some best practices to navigate them:
Common Challenges:
- Initial Setup Complexity: Establishing a robust token system and the associated tooling can be time-consuming initially, especially for larger, existing projects.
- Team Adoption and Education: Ensuring that both designers and developers understand and embrace the concept of design tokens and how to use them correctly is crucial.
- Maintaining Token Structure: As the design system evolves, keeping the token structure organized, consistent, and well-documented requires ongoing effort.
- Tooling Limitations: Some existing workflows or legacy systems might not integrate seamlessly with tokenization tools, requiring custom solutions.
- Cross-Platform Nuances: While tokens aim for abstraction, subtle platform-specific design conventions might still require some level of customization in the generated code.
Best Practices for Success:
- Start Small and Iterate: Don't try to tokenize your entire design system at once. Begin with a subset of critical properties (e.g., colors, typography) and expand gradually.
- Establish Clear Naming Conventions: Consistent and descriptive naming is paramount. Follow a logical structure (e.g.,
category-type-variantorsemantic-purpose-state). - Prioritize Semantic Tokens: These are key for flexibility and maintainability. They abstract the 'why' behind a design property, enabling easier theming and updates.
- Integrate with Design Tools: Leverage plugins like Tokens Studio for Figma to ensure design and development are aligned from the outset.
- Automate Everything Possible: Use tools like Style Dictionary to automate the transformation of tokens into platform-specific code. This reduces manual errors and saves time.
- Comprehensive Documentation: Create clear documentation for your token system, explaining the purpose, usage, and values of each token. This is vital for team onboarding and ongoing reference.
- Version Control Your Tokens: Treat your design token definitions as code and store them in a version control system (e.g., Git) to track changes and collaborate effectively.
- Regular Audits: Periodically review your token system to ensure it remains relevant, efficient, and aligned with evolving design needs and best practices.
- Embrace Incremental Adoption: If migrating a large, existing project, consider an incremental approach. Start by tokenizing new components or sections before refactoring older ones.
Case Study Snippet: A Global FinTech's Journey
A leading global FinTech company, serving millions of users across North America, Europe, and Asia, faced significant challenges with maintaining brand consistency across their web platform, iOS app, and Android app. Their design system was fragmented, with different teams using slightly varying color palettes and typography scales. This led to user confusion and increased development effort for bug fixes and feature parity.
Solution: They adopted a comprehensive design token strategy using Tokens Studio for Figma and Style Dictionary. They began by defining core and semantic tokens for colors, typography, and spacing in Figma. These tokens were then exported to a shared JSON format.
Transformation: Style Dictionary was configured to transform these JSON tokens into:
- CSS Custom Properties for their React-based web application.
- Swift constants for their iOS application's UI components.
- Kotlin constants and style definitions for their Android application.
Outcome: The FinTech company saw a dramatic improvement in cross-platform consistency. Brand elements were visually identical across all touchpoints. The ability to quickly generate new themes (e.g., for specific regional marketing campaigns or dark mode) was reduced from weeks to days. Development teams reported faster iteration times and a significant reduction in UI-related bugs, freeing up resources to focus on new feature development.
